What Do I Do?

Okay, time for a new poem. This one applies to two of my best friends...you probably know who you are...so I wrote this for you. It was a while ago, but it's still true.

What do you do
when you have no idea what's supposed to be done?
What do you say
when you have no clue what's supposed to be said?
How do you comfort someone,
one of your best friends in the world,
when you don't know where to begin?
Nothing's going to cut it.
Everything you say is going to roll off her back,
and it won't make a difference.
Because you know that if you were in her shoes,
there would be nothing to make you feel better
except the one who made you feel this way in the first place.
